Bill Summary
For legislation relative to concurrent jurisdiction on National Park Service properties. Environment and Natural Resources.
AI Summary
This bill amends existing legislation to grant the Commonwealth of Massachusetts concurrent jurisdiction over lands, waters, and buildings acquired, leased, or administratively controlled by the National Park Service within the state. The bill specifies that concurrent jurisdiction will vest in the United States when the Director of the National Park Service files a notice of acceptance with the state governor and secretary. This change provides for shared authority between the state and federal government over National Park Service properties located in Massachusetts.
